Ed Hernandez
I’ve been here a few times and have always had a great time . Personally my favorite is during the colder months , they start serving tortilla soup. All other times I’ve ordered chilaquiles mild. If you’re feeling adventurous and want to try the hot version, they offer to put some of the hot sauce in a little cup so you can control the heat. The staff is very attentive and always makes sure my glass or mug is full. If you’re visiting bethel, then I’d recommend this place and the bar right next door.
